Hartford Police Investigate After Semi-Automatic Rifle Fired

Police responded to the area of Love Lane and Waverly Street in Hartford this morning after a man reportedly fired shots into the air from outside a nearby home, authorities said.

According to police, a man who lived in the area fired a semi-automatic rifle from his porch after getting into a domestic dispute. Police were called to the scene, where they discovered empty shell casings outside the home. The Hartford Emergency Response Team also responded to the scene.

Officers learned that Officers learned that the suspect had run to an abandoned building at 21 Love Lane. There they found a Ruger Mini-14 rifle, police said.

The suspect was nowhere to be found.

Police are still investigating the incident and expect to issue an arrest warrant.
